What to Look for in MagSafe Power Bank for iPhone 16 Pro

Picking the wrong MagSafe power bank means dealing with slow charging, weak magnets that let your phone slip off, or a brick that weighs down your pocket. I’ve tested dozens, and most buyers mess up by ignoring wattage ratings or assuming all magnetic banks hold equally well. Here’s what actually matters.

Wireless Charging Speed (Wattage)

The iPhone 16 Pro supports up to 15W wireless charging through MagSafe, but not every bank delivers that. Look for Qi2 certification—it guarantees full 15W speed, while older uncertified banks often top out at 5W or 7.5W. I always check the output wattage in the specs before buying, because a 5W bank will charge your phone painfully slow. Rule of thumb: if it doesn’t say Qi2 or 15W, assume it’s slow.

Battery Capacity (mAh)

Capacity tells you how much extra juice you’re carrying. A 5,000mAh bank gives roughly a 70-80% top-up to a drained iPhone 16 Pro, while 10,000mAh can fully recharge it once with some leftover. I use 5,000mAh for daily pocket carry and 10,000mAh for travel or long days away from outlets. Just remember that higher capacity also means more weight and thickness.

Magnetic Hold Strength

A weak magnet is the fastest way to hate your power bank. The bank needs to snap on firmly and stay put even in a pocket or bag, because a loose connection stops charging. I test this by shaking the phone gently with the bank attached—if it slides even a millimeter, it’s a pass. Anker and Baseus models generally have the strongest magnets in my experience.

Size and Portability

MagSafe banks live on the back of your phone, so thickness and weight matter more than with regular power banks. Ultra-slim models under 0.6 inches are comfortable for daily carry, while thicker ones with built-in stands add versatility but feel bulky. I personally won’t daily-carry anything over 10,000mAh because it makes the phone too heavy to use one-handed.

Wired Charging Speed (USB-C Port)

Even if you buy a wireless bank, the USB-C port matters for faster top-ups. Look for at least 20W Power Delivery output so you can plug in and get a quick charge when wireless is too slow. Some banks also let you charge the bank itself and your phone simultaneously through the same port—a handy feature I always appreciate on trips.

Extra Features That Actually Help

A built-in kickstand turns your power bank into a phone stand for watching videos, and a built-in cable means you never forget a cord. I find these features worth the extra bulk if you travel often or watch a lot of content on your phone. Just don’t pay extra for features you won’t use—a simple slim bank is better than a bulky one with a stand you never open.

How many watts do I need for fast MagSafe charging on iPhone 16 Pro?

You need at least 15W of wireless output to get the fastest MagSafe speeds on an iPhone 16 Pro. Banks with Qi2 certification guarantee that 15W, while older uncertified models often cap at 5W or 7.5W. I always check for Qi2 or a stated 15W wireless output before buying.

Is a 5,000mAh MagSafe power bank enough for a full day?

For light to moderate use, yes—a 5,000mAh bank like the Anker MagGo gives you about a 70-80% top-up, which is enough to get through a workday. If you’re a heavy user who streams video or plays games, you’ll want a 10,000mAh bank like the Anker 633 Magnetic Battery for a full recharge. I carry a 5,000mAh daily and grab a 10,000mAh for travel.

What’s the difference between Qi2 and standard MagSafe power banks?

Qi2 is the official certification that guarantees 15W wireless charging, while standard uncertified banks often deliver only 5W or 7.5W. Qi2 also ensures better magnetic alignment and consistent charging speeds. I always choose Qi2 banks because the faster charging is worth the small price difference.

How long does a 10,000mAh MagSafe power bank take to recharge itself?

With a 20W USB-C charger, a 10,000mAh bank like the Anker 633 takes about 3-4 hours to fully recharge. Banks with faster USB-C input, like the Baseus Picogo AM52 with 45W, can recharge in around 2 hours. I plug mine in overnight so it’s ready to go in the morning.

Will a MagSafe power bank work with an iPhone 16 Pro case on?

It depends on the case thickness. Most slim MagSafe-compatible cases work fine, but thick or non-MagSafe cases block the magnetic connection and reduce charging speed. I recommend using a case with built-in magnets for the strongest hold, or removing thick cases before attaching the bank.
